#include "address_range.h"
|
|
#include "ip_address.h"
|
|
#include "ipv6_address.h"
|
|
|
|
namespace Tins {
|
|
IPv4Range operator/(const IPv4Address &addr, int mask) {
|
|
if(mask > 32)
|
|
throw std::logic_error("Prefix length cannot exceed 32");
|
|
return IPv4Range::from_mask(
|
|
addr,
|
|
IPv4Address(Endian::host_to_be(0xffffffff << (32 - mask)))
|
|
);
|
|
}
|
|
|
|
IPv6Range operator/(const IPv6Address &addr, int mask) {
|
|
if(mask > 128)
|
|
throw std::logic_error("Prefix length cannot exceed 128");
|
|
IPv6Address last_addr;
|
|
IPv6Address::iterator it = last_addr.begin();
|
|
while(mask > 8) {
|
|
*it = 0xff;
|
|
++it;
|
|
mask -= 8;
|
|
}
|
|
*it = 0xff << (8 - mask);
|
|
return IPv6Range::from_mask(addr, last_addr);
|
|
}
|
|
} |
